Worker deployment in dual resource constrained systems with a task-type factor
Authors:John R Zamiska  Mohamad Y Jaber  Hemant V Kher
Institution:1. Department of Mechanical and Industrial Engineering, Ryerson University, Toronto, ON, Canada M5B 2K3;2. Department of Business Administration, Alfred Lerner College of Business and Economics, University of Delaware, Newark, DE 19716, USA
Abstract:This paper investigates worker learning and forgetting phenomenon in a dual resource constrained system (DRC) setting. Worker learning and forgetting in two and three stage DRC systems are modeled according to the dual-phase learning and forgetting model (DPLFM), which is based on the theory that a task has separate cognitive and motor requirements. Results show that the task-type (with respect to its learning rate and proportion of cognitive and motor requirements) affects the performance of training and deployment policies in DRC systems, and as such it should be included in future DRC research.
Keywords:Learning  Forgetting  DRC  Cognitive tasks  Motor tasks  Worker flexibility  Deployment policies  Human performance
